Celebrating the Cooperative in Sooke

 
Awareness Film Night and Sooke Transition Initiative present Celebrating the Cooperative
The evening will feature the film "Civilizing the Economy" and a discussion on bringing sustainable inspired cooperative development to our region. 
 
"Civilizing the Economy", directed by Vancouver Island's Tom Shandel, takes the viewer to the Emilia-Romagna area of northern Italy where 45% of the GDP is from cooperatives. 
 
After the hour-long film, Don Brown and Andrew Moore will present ideas on how we can encourage and develop more cooperatives in our neighborhood.

Don, BSc., MBA, is a Cooperative Development Consultant with more than 30 years experience in national and international development consulting.  Andrew is a Certified Cooperative Developer who has helped establish and operate a host of different co-ops in the U.K., South Africa and B.C.
